


COVID-19 South Africa Facebook Mobility Index
This page is used to show Facebook Movement Range Data to explain how humans are responding to physical distancing measures.
There are two metrics:
* People Moving around: How much people were less moving around after COVID -19.
* People Localized to home: People who were localized near or with in home.
To understand how movement has changed over time, Facebook establish a baseline period for comparison for that Facebook uses four weeks of February, from the 2nd to the 29th, as a baseline period.
Movement Range Trends were collected for the people who enable Location history and Background location collection services on the Facebook on a mobile device:

FB quantify how much people move around by counting the number of level-16 Bing tiles( ~600 meters x 600 meters in area at the equator) they are seen within a day:
